What types of cyber attacks are most common?
Cyber attacks come in many forms, and it's important to be aware of the most common types to protect your business. Here are some of the most common types of cyber attacks:
  1. Phishing: This type of attack involves sending fake emails or messages that appear to be from a legitimate source, tricking the victim into divulging sensitive information or downloading malicious software.
  2. Malware: This type of attack involves the use of malicious software to gain access to a victim's systems or steal sensitive information. Malware can come in the form of viruses, worms, or Trojans.
  3. Ransomware: This type of attack involves the encryption of a victim's data, rendering it inaccessible until a ransom is paid to the attackers.
Why is cybersecurity so important?
Cybersecurity is more important than ever in today's digital age. With the increasing reliance on technology and the Internet, businesses of all sizes are at risk of cyber attacks. Here are a few reasons why cybersecurity is so important:
  • Protecting sensitive data: Cyber attacks can result in the theft of sensitive data, such as customer information or intellectual property. This can have serious consequences for businesses, including financial loss and damage to reputation.
  • Maintaining business operations: Cyber attacks can disrupt business operations, leading to lost revenue and a decline in productivity. By investing in cybersecurity measures, businesses can minimize the risk of disruptions and maintain a smooth and efficient workflow.
  • Protecting against financial loss: Cyber attacks can result in direct financial loss, such as the cost of paying a ransom or the cost of replacing damaged systems. They can also result in indirect financial loss, such as lost revenue due to a disruption in business operations or damage to reputation.
  • Protecting against legal consequences: In some cases, businesses may face legal consequences for failing to protect sensitive data or for failing to disclose a cyber attack. By investing in cybersecurity measures, businesses can minimize their risk of legal action.
What is the consequence of a cyber attack?
The consequences of a cyber attack can be severe and can impact businesses of all sizes. Some potential consequences of a cyber attack include:
  1. Loss of sensitive data: Cyber attacks can result in the theft of sensitive data, such as customer information or intellectual property. This can have serious consequences for businesses, including financial loss and damage to reputation.
  2. Financial loss: Cyber attacks can result in direct financial loss, such as the cost of paying a ransom or the cost of replacing damaged systems. They can also result in indirect financial loss, such as lost revenue due to a disruption in business operations or damage to reputation.
  3. Reputation damage: A cyber attack can severely damage a business's reputation, particularly if sensitive customer data is compromised. This can lead to a loss of customers and a decline in business.
  4. Legal consequences: In some cases, businesses may face legal consequences for failing to protect sensitive data or for failing to disclose a cyber attack.
  5. Risk of bankruptcy due to improper cybersecurity (60% of small businesses that experience a cyber attack go out of business within six months).
